US Short Code Registry

For the US Short Code Registry, the goal was to create a platform that made it easier for businesses to search for, understand, and manage SMS short codes. I worked on the main site build and also collaborated with another developer to create an internal application that powered the site’s biggest feature: finding and validating short-code availability.

The application allowed users to:

Search 5–6 digit short codes

Look up patterns like sequential, easy-to-remember, or repeating numbers

Instantly check availability against the registry

Browse categorized results to discover alternative options

While the interface was designed to feel simple, the system handled a fair amount of logic and validation behind the scenes to ensure accuracy and speed.

This project stands out as a blend of clean UX, logical flow, and functional search tooling built directly into the site rather than relying on an external system.
